Setup, Compatibility & Care
Setup:
- Ensure the surface is clean, dry, and smooth. Remove any dust, grease, or old adhesive.
- Measure and cut the vinyl wrap to the required size, adding a small overlap for trimming.
- Slowly peel back the backing paper while carefully applying the vinyl to the surface, using a squeegee to smooth out air bubbles.
- For corners or edges, gently warm the vinyl with a hairdryer to make it more pliable before applying.
Compatibility:
This vinyl is best suited for smooth, non-porous surfaces such as:
- Laminated furniture
- Painted walls (ensure paint is fully cured)
- Glass
- Metal
- Melamine-faced chipboard
Avoid applying to porous, rough, or excessively textured surfaces where adhesion may be compromised.
Care:
Clean the surface regularly with a damp cloth and mild soapy water.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or scouring pads, as these can damage the vinyl's finish. For stubborn marks, a solution of warm water and a mild detergent should suffice. Ensure the surface is dried thoroughly after cleaning.
